1965 Alfa Romeo Spider vs. 1988 Acura Legend
To start off, 1988 Acura Legend is newer by 23 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1965 Alfa Romeo Spider.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1965 Alfa Romeo Spider would be higher. At 2,700 cc (6 cylinders), 1988 Acura Legend is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, both vehicles can yield 163 horse power. So under normal driving conditions, the acceleration of both vehicles should be relatively similar.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1988 Acura Legend weights approximately 30 kg more than 1965 Alfa Romeo Spider.
Compare all specifications:
1965 Alfa Romeo Spider | 1988 Acura Legend | |
Make | Alfa Romeo | Acura |
Model | Spider | Legend |
Year Released | 1965 | 1988 |
Body Type | Roadster | Sedan |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 2582 cc | 2700 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 6 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| V |
Valves per Cylinder | 2 valves | 4 valves |
Horse Power | 163 HP | 163 HP |
Engine Compression Ratio | 9.2:1 | 9.0:1 |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Number of Seats | 2 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 4 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 1330 kg | 1360 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4510 mm | 4820 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1610 mm | 1740 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1390 mm | 1400 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2510 mm | 2770 mm |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 46 L | 61 L |
